WebDec 16, 2024 · The role of Nephrology: Lithium is known to cause a variety of renal diseases when it is used over a long period generally spanning several years. Kidney disease spectra includes acute lithium toxicity, nephrogenic diabetes insipidus (can occur in up to 40% of users), incomplete distal renal tubular acidosis, nephrotic syndrome …
